Welcome! Quick context on the session-token refresh bug in Bramblegate. Short version: refreshed tokens weren't rotating their signing nonce, so a stolen refresh token stayed valid way longer than intended. The fix landed in the auth service, but we kept the old token table around so you can audit what was issued during the window. You'll want to poke at the issuance logs yourself rather than trust our summary. The audit replica holding those records is reachable via the connection string below.

replica DSN, yahaf-yagaf: mongodb://tamath_svc:a2netSk3RZMuTj@db-d084.novacsoft.internal:5432/ralmir

### FAQ: Why does Memlattice need an unlock step before profiling?

Memlattice, our GPU memory profiler, attaches to live allocator hooks, so raw heap snapshots can expose tenant data. Reviewers approving profiling PRs should know captures are encrypted at rest and only decodable inside the Driftvale sandbox. If a reviewer must inspect a snapshot locally to verify allocation maps, the sandbox exporter requires an unlock. For that case, the exporter accepts the recovery passphrase shown below.

strongbox words: wenix-ulador

CHANGELOG — Brindlewave Firmware Channel, week 34

Defaults changed for the Brindlewave device-firmware update channel. Rollout cohort size drops from 10% to 5% after the Oakhollow fleet saw elevated rollback rates. Staged-bake time doubles, and delta updates are now the default instead of full images. Devices on the legacy channel are unaffected until next cycle. Marnie flagged that dashboards need re-baselining. The new default configuration shipped with this change is listed below.

config for yajep-tafof:
[rusath]
team = julmir
access_code = ac_fe37fd
host = rusath.novactech.test
port = 8000
owner = pelmir.weneth
peer = oliwyn.olvarqdyn.internal

### Websocket reconnect bug (Pipershade gateway)

Quick recap for the sync: clients hitting the Pipershade gateway reconnect in a tight loop after idle timeouts because the backoff timer resets on handshake, not on auth success. Workaround is bumping the idle window to 90s via the admin endpoint. To run the repro script against staging, use the internal service key below.

service key, fawip-bajef: kto11_Qt5wZK9vdNC